To make ground turkey meatballs, you will need the following ingredients:
- 1 pound ground turkey
- 1/2 cup bread crumbs
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/4 cup chopped onion
- 1/4 cup chopped parsley
- 1 egg
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
Instructions: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- In a large bowl, combine all ingredients and mix well.
- Form the mixture into 1-inch meatballs.
- Place the meatballs on a baking sheet and bake for 15-20 minutes, or until cooked through.

Cooking method
The cooking method you choose for your ground turkey meatballs will have a significant impact on their texture and flavor. Baked meatballs are typically more tender and juicy, while fried meatballs are more crispy and browned. Grilled meatballs have a slightly smoky flavor and a more firm texture.
- Baking: Baking is a good option for those who want tender and juicy meatballs. To bake your meatballs, preheat your o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Place the meatballs on the prepared baking sheet and bake for 15-20 minutes, or until cooked through.
- Frying: Frying is a good option for those who want crispy and browned meatballs. To fry your meatballs, heat a large skillet over medium heat and add enough oil to coat the bottom of the skillet. Place the meatballs in the hot oil and cook for 5-7 minutes per side, or until cooked through.
- Grilling: Grilling is a good option for those who want meatballs with a slightly smoky flavor. To grill your meatballs, preheat your grill to medium-high heat. Place the meatballs on the grill and cook for 10-12 minutes, or until cooked through.
No matter which cooking method you choose, be sure to cook your meatballs to an internal temperature of 165 degrees F (74 degrees C) to ensure that they are safe to eat.

Question 3: Can I make ground turkey meatballs ahead of time?
Answer: Yes, you can make ground turkey meatballs ahead of time. Simply form the meatballs and place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Freeze the meatballs for at least 2 hours, or until solid. Once frozen, the meatballs can be stored in a freezer-safe container for up to 3 months.
